Williams College welcomes applications for the Gaius Charles Bolin Dissertation Fellowship from current graduate students in Mathematics and Statistics. This fellowship is designed to promote diversity on college faculties by encouraging students from underrepresented groups to complete a terminal graduate degree and to pursue careers in college teaching.
